The realistic cashier station became my command center. When Mrs. Peterson's grocery conveyor overflowed with items during lunch rush, my fingers flew across the screen—scanning cereal boxes while mentally calculating discounts. The satisfying cha-ching sound after correct change always sparks dopamine, especially when impatient customers transform into smiling regulars through efficient service. Managing that delicate balance between speed and accuracy makes every shift feel like a high-stakes game show.
Product diversification revolutionized my gameplay. Unlocking the electronics section felt like Christmas morning—suddenly teenagers clustered around phone chargers while musicians tested keyboards. The tactile joy of dragging designer shoes onto display racks contrasts beautifully with arranging rainbow-colored fruit pyramids. Each new category attracts distinct customer personalities, forcing strategic placement decisions. I remember rearranging my entire store layout after noticing how liquor aisle browsers often impulse-bought gourmet snacks.
Watching my humble corner shop evolve into a mega-hypermarket delivered unparalleled pride. That moment when neon "Grand Opening" signs illuminated my expanded clothing section, triggering a 30% revenue spike, had me cheering aloud. The 3D upgrades aren't cosmetic fluff; wider aisles reduce customer collisions while premium checkout counters slash queue times. Investing in floral displays near registers was my secret weapon—customers grabbing last-minute bouquets boosted average transaction values.

What shines: Launching takes seconds even on older devices, crucial for sneaking gameplay between meetings. The economic feedback loop hooks you—seeing daily profit charts climb after optimizing prices creates real accomplishment. Room for growth? During holiday events when aisles jam with virtual shoppers, I'd love adjustable game speed to prevent overwhelmed newbies. Some premium items require grinding that could frustrate casual players, though watching ads strategically solves this.
